Spinach Dip

You'll hear me say this on all of the recipes, but people just LOVE this dip!

Its sooo easy to make and you can do it up the night before.  Just don't put the dip in the bread bowl or it will get a bit soggy.  

Keep the dip in a bowl till you are ready to eat or let it sit in the bread bowl a few hours before  eating it.  It makes the bread bowl itself totally yummers! 

 People will be breaking off the sides of the bowl to eat the soaked in flavor once the bread pieces are gone! :D

Ingredients/Instructions

1 round sourdough bread for bowl

1 16oz sour cream (only use the real stuff. The light and non-fat just don't taste right)

1 8oz real mayonnaise (same here. Don't skip on the flavor)

1 bunch green onions (slice thinly)

1 and 1/2 cups shredded cheese (your choice, but I always use mild cheddar)

1 pkg. chopped frozen spinach (drain and squeeze out excess liquid)

1 small crown broccoli (shave tips into mixture)

Salt and pepper to taste.

Mix the above ingredients and pour into bowl that you make from bread round.  Slice the extra bread into bite size pieces. Best if made the night before.
